The Cat's Pajamas are an explosive vocal band based out of Madison, WI. Singing everything from classic rock to doo wop, from barbershop to hits you hear on the radio today, The Cat's Pajamas repertoire transcends typical genre tastes. They are a group that truly anyone will enjoy!

The Cat's Pajamas is a phenomenal show with five guys, Brian Skinner, Chris Rossi, John Patrick, Nate Mendl, and Zakk Wooten, who sing a capella, make drum, guitar, and all sorts of instrument sounds using nothing but their voices and microphones. The Cat's Pajamas sing all sorts of music from the 1950's to today. Some of the songs they sing are Some Kind of Wonderful, Love Potion #9, Pretty Woman, Proud Mary, Hound Dog, Heartbreak Hotel, Oh, What a Night, Hooked on a Feeling, Stand By Me, Mustang Sally, and many more great songs.
